The enhanced mechanism of Fe(III)/H2O2 system by N, S-doped mesoporous nanocarbon for the degradation of sulfamethoxazole

•Novel nitrogen, sulfur co-doped nanocarbon materials were synthesized to enhance Fe(III)/H2O2 system.•The structure and functional groups of NSC which conduct effective catalysis were revealed.•Two Fe(III)/Fe(II) cycling pathways were verified in NSC/Fe(III)/H2O2 process.•Intermediate and possible degradation pathways ofa SMX were proposed.
